Powell Is on the Cusp of Taking a Big Gamble With the U.S. Economy

August 21, 2025

Jerome Powell, the Federal Reserve chair, is managing a high-stakes balancing act as he grapples with a cooling labor market, rising inflation and White House pressure to cut interest rates.
